Default 8 YARDS..yet no cigar.

Well, wish I could be posting a first archery buck right about now, but it just didnt pan out. This was my first time setting foot on this piece since last December, and it was well worth the wait.

I dont know if it was because I left it undisturbed, or its just that time of year...but deer were moving today excellent. I saw 5 deer from stand, all within 60-70 yards and all were bucks.

Morning started with a 4 point passing by at 30 yards, elected to not fling an arrow.

Heard a hen on the distant ridge, so I got out the diaphram and got her all fired up in hopes of having her come in. She definitely closed ground, but I gave up on her. Next I knew of her she was at 20 yards, and I was twiddling thumbs, LOL. Got the bow off the hook fine but she busted me drawing.


About 830 I got that feeling. Can't describe it but you can just tell there are deer in the area. Stood up and was glassing the woods behind the stand, when I heard something behind me (infront of stand). I slowly turn to see a nice 8 jogging down the trail straight for me, he dips down into the creek bed to cross, so I grab the bow. He is already in range when he pops up on my side....but heading straight for me....he closes the distance to 8 yards before he turns broadside....right behind a still green and heavy leaved sapling. I couldnt bring myself to try and snake an arrow in there for the kill, so I waited at full draw for about2 minutes before letting down. 2 more steps and he was mine, but he turns and feeds straight away from me never turning broadside again until 50 yards out. I contemplated the texas heart shot. He was about 115ish, a heck of a would be buck for my first, especially the way this year has gone thus far.

A small 8, (i thought was a 6, which is why I didnt shoot) followed him about 2 minutes later. I had numerous shot ops, but who takes the shot at a smaller 6 while a bigger 8 is still in shot?[8D] I hang the bow and reach for the binos before they are out of sight to get a better look at them...and I realize both are 8s. about 115-120 and 100 respectively.

walked up within 30 yards of a differnt 4 pointer on the sneak out of stand at 11. Froze against side of tree, and he literally walked within 2-3 feet of me being able to grab his antlers, lol.

This pm had higher swirling winds,(so much for weather.com predictions)so I didnt have much hopes. did see one deer, but I only caught the flash of antlers as he was behind a cane thicket, and I couldnt tell how big. By the time I had binos on him he was out of sight.



So ill be back out in the am, with a confidence boost this time. Sitting on stand later sure is easier after an 8 yard encounter with a buck you now consider a shooter, i was shakin like a leaf after he was out of range. I did this on the pronghorn I shot too, didnt get shaken up until afterwards. I've got a good feeling about this year.
